    Indian actress Lehar Khan, known for her captivating roles in films like Jalpari: The Desert Mermaid (2012), Parched (2015), Brahmāstra (2022), and Jawan (2023), shared a poem on her Instagram with her 203K followers in July 2024. The poem, inspired by the book Eden Abandoned: The Story of Lilith, reflects themes of empowerment, individuality, and defiance against societal expectations.

    Lehar’s poem, “I would rather be,” draws inspiration from Lilith, a figure from Jewish mythology often portrayed as Adam’s first wife. Unlike Eve, Lilith was said to be made from the same earth as Adam, not from his rib, symbolizing equality and independence. This narrative aligns with Lehar’s message of breaking free from patriarchal structures and embracing personal freedom.

    Here’s the Lehar Khan poem she shared:

    “I would rather be”

    I am not the Eve you can tie up in your house
    I m the Lilith who runs wild
    I m made with the same clay as you
    I was not made out of you
    Not for you
    But like you
    And so how do you expect me to bow down
    I have the same spine as you
    Strong and unbendable
    The only difference is
    You want everyone to kneel in front of you
    While I m okay with standing eye to eye
    Isn’t that what scares you
    That’s when you look away

    I would rather be your Lilith
    And leave
    Than be your Eve
    And stay forever.

    – लehaर
